So far, the so called, "leader of the biggest reform party in
parliament, Mohammed Reza Khatami, resigned and accused the Guardian
Council of killing all opportunities for resolving the dispute."
"There is no hope for a solution. We will not participate in this
sham election. Even if all those disqualified are reinstated today,
there will be no time for competition. Elections on February 20th are
illegitimate," said Reza Khatami, the president's younger brother
and a deputy speaker.
